A Russian Proprietor: And Other Stories is a collection of short stories written by Leo Tolstoy and first published in 1888. The book contains eleven stories, each depicting the lives of different characters in Russia during the late 19th century. The title story, A Russian Proprietor, follows the life of a wealthy landowner who becomes disillusioned with his privileged position and begins to question the morality of his actions. Other stories in the collection include The Death of Ivan Ilyich, which explores the themes of mortality and the search for meaning in life, and The Kreutzer Sonata, which examines the destructive power of jealousy and sexual desire.Tolstoy's writing style is characterized by its realism and attention to detail, and his stories often explore the complexities of human relationships and the struggles of ordinary people. The collection is considered a masterpiece of Russian literature and has been translated into numerous languages.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
